Climate and Weather in Hope Forest, AU

Hope Forest is a charming rural locality located in the state of South Australia, Australia. Situated just 30 kilometers south of Adelaide, Hope Forest experiences a unique climate characterized by its Mediterranean influences. The region enjoys warm summers, mild winters, and a relatively low annual rainfall. Let's explore the climate and weather patterns in Hope Forest throughout the year.

Temperature

The temperature in Hope Forest varies throughout the year, with distinct seasons. Summers in the region are typically warm, with average temperatures ranging from 25°C to 30°C (77°F to 86°F). January is usually the hottest month, with temperatures occasionally reaching over 40°C (104°F). However, the coastal location provides relief from extreme heat, thanks to the cooling sea breezes.

Winters in Hope Forest are generally mild, with average temperatures ranging from 12°C to 16°C (54°F to 61°F). July is the coldest month, with temperatures occasionally dropping to around 5°C (41°F) during the night. Frost is rare in the area, and snowfall is extremely rare, if not nonexistent.

Rainfall

Hope Forest experiences a Mediterranean climate with a relatively low annual rainfall. The wettest months are typically from May to September, with average monthly rainfall ranging from 40mm to 70mm (1.6 inches to 2.8 inches). October is the rainiest month, with occasional thunderstorms bringing heavy downpours to the region.

During the summer months, the rainfall decreases significantly, with average monthly precipitation ranging from 15mm to 25mm (0.6 inches to 1 inch). The region experiences a dry period from December to February, with February being the driest month of the year.

Sunshine Hours

Hope Forest enjoys a generous amount of sunshine throughout the year, making it an ideal place for outdoor activities and agricultural practices. On average, the region receives around 8 to 9 hours of sunshine per day. Summers are particularly sunny, with December being the sunniest month.

Wind

The coastal location of Hope Forest also influences the wind patterns in the area. The prevailing winds blow from the southwest during the summer months, bringing cool breezes from the ocean. In contrast, during winter, the winds tend to come from the north and northeast, resulting in warmer temperatures.

Climate Summary

Hope Forest's climate can be summarized as a mild Mediterranean climate with warm summers, mild winters, and a low annual rainfall. The table below provides a summary of the average monthly temperature and rainfall in the region:

Month Average Temperature (°C) Average Rainfall (mm)
January 25 - 30 15 - 25
February 25 - 30 10 - 20
March 23 - 28 10 - 20
April 19 - 24 20 - 30
May 16 - 20 40 - 50
June 13 - 16 50 - 60
July 12 - 16 50 - 60
August 13 - 17 40 - 50
September 15 - 19 30 - 40
October 18 - 23 40 - 50
November 21 - 26 30 - 40
December 24 - 29 20 - 30

Source: Australian Bureau of Meteorology
